Title: Fork oil height for '84 KX125C1 forks?
Post by: John Orchard on August 27, 2013, 02:09:59 pm
Would anyone have the fork oil height for an '84 KX125 ?
Title: Re: Fork oil height for '84 KX125C1 forks?
Post by: Grunter215 on August 27, 2013, 03:12:59 pm
Hey John.  book says...602-610 cc....oil level 178-182 mm( 7 inch )

Race Tech website says 135mm, I'll try both  :-)
Title: Re: Fork oil height for '84 KX125C1 forks?
Post by: JohnnyO on August 27, 2013, 09:59:14 pm
130mm is a good setting for any Evo, pre 85, pre 90 conventional forks. The std settings in the manual are not necessarily the best settings, bit like std jetting..
